Rethinking the Rerun

Oct 27, 2003  •  Post A Comment

Broadcasters used to rerun shows to cover their costs. Today, some of TV’s most popular shows, including reality programs and serial dramas, don’t repeat well, and many viewers prefer to watch original fare on cable or surf the Internet. That is throwing the economics of prime-time TV into a tailspin. Leslie Ryan reports. Page 36
